The invention relates to channel configuration field in mobile communication and especially to a method and an apparatus for controlling a stand-alone dedicated control channel SDCCH request. The method and the apparatus resolves a problem that a low SDCCH access success rate results when a large amount of noise access requests occurs in a network in the prior art. The method of an embodiment of the invention comprises: determining whether the times of stand-alone dedicated control channel SDCCH requests received within a set time length is more than a set threshold value; and if the times of received SDCCH requests is more than the set threshold value, discarding the received SDCCH requests after the times of SDCCH requests reaches the threshold value. technical field [0001] The present invention relates to the field of channel configuration in mobile communication, in particular to a method and device for controlling a Stand-Alone Dedicated Control Channel (SDCCH) request. Background technique [0002] The Global System of Mobile communication (GSM) network is the largest wireless communication network in the world. Operators are paying more and more attention to various key performance indicators (Key Performance Indication, KPI) in the construction of GSM networks. Manufacturers are trying to improve KPI indicators are making unremitting efforts. Among them, SDCCH access success rate and blocking rate, as two indicators in KPI indicators, have been used as regular network assessment indicators. In the process of using the network, it is found that there is a kind of false random access similar to "ghost" in the network access, which has brought adverse effects on KPI indicators.
